summary refs log tree commit diff
diff options
context:
space:
mode:
authorDanny Wilson <danny@prime.vc>2015-11-07 05:14:15 +0100
committerDanny Wilson <danny@prime.vc>2015-11-16 17:20:15 +0100
commitcaaded37135131d9a282d66fd44591caf5b169c7 (patch)
treef33f039c63a730d05a2c499390ecc38893f962e3
parent340375f42111310a5401a644d12f987fe0a61252 (diff)
downloadnixlib-caaded37135131d9a282d66fd44591caf5b169c7.tar
nixlib-caaded37135131d9a282d66fd44591caf5b169c7.tar.gz
nixlib-caaded37135131d9a282d66fd44591caf5b169c7.tar.bz2
nixlib-caaded37135131d9a282d66fd44591caf5b169c7.tar.lz
nixlib-caaded37135131d9a282d66fd44591caf5b169c7.tar.xz
nixlib-caaded37135131d9a282d66fd44591caf5b169c7.tar.zst
nixlib-caaded37135131d9a282d66fd44591caf5b169c7.zip
Disable inotify support on SunOS: it’s Linux-specific.
This amazingly fixes the coreutils build on SmartOS.
-rw-r--r--pkgs/tools/misc/coreutils/default.nix2
1 files changed, 2 insertions, 0 deletions
diff --git a/pkgs/tools/misc/coreutils/default.nix b/pkgs/tools/misc/coreutils/default.nix
index bd0d1b928570..9f763115f9a9 100644
--- a/pkgs/tools/misc/coreutils/default.nix
+++ b/pkgs/tools/misc/coreutils/default.nix
@@ -36,6 +36,8 @@ let
          touch -r src/stat.c src/tail.c
        '';
 
+    configureFlags = optionalString stdenv.isSunOS "ac_cv_func_inotify_init=no";
+
     nativeBuildInputs = [ perl ];
     buildInputs = [ gmp ]
       ++ optional aclSupport acl